2020-02-25

第一天接触spring

环境变量可以不用配置,如果用了集群之后反而有缺点

在pom.xml中有三种打包方式,<paging>jar war pom
pom中paging标签里面写啥就表示打包成啥,不写的话默认是jar

记住在idea创建maven之后第一时间点击右下角的那个auto的那个啥玩意

sts要想运行,右键项目,打开maven bulid,然后手动输入一下Tomcat:run

IoC AOP
首先写依赖,spring-context,然后写一个bean在main的resources文件下(这里面放的都是配置文件),最后写Spring测试类

如果pom里面bean下写的是properties的时候,bean对象里面必须写默认的无参构造器,光光有全参构造器是不行的,或者不写构造器,系统会默认生成无参构造器,如果遇到我们只需要全参构造器,那么我就用constructor-arg来写 而且bean对象里面的set,get方法必须要写

spring默认生成的对象是单例模式

scope有四个值,request,session,singleton(单例) prototype(多例) 默认是单例的,无论getbean多少次都是同一个对象,如果换成prototype的话,getbean几次就获取几个对象

servlet在web下也是单例

混合调用指的是一个四参构造器和用set方法获取
name + value; 直接value;index+value;type+value;
对象的注入:name+ref
重复类型还得要注意顺序匹配(type+value)

©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

友情链接更多精彩内容